					  <title><![CDATA[Alexander McQueen&#039;s Successor]]></title>
					  <link>http://www.fashionnewspaper.com/articles/3910/1/Alexander-McQueen039s-Successor/Page1.html</link>
					  <description><![CDATA[To end its mournful sadness the PPR is rising to re-vivify the McQueen label. According to the flash news of Daily Telegraph web-page the label's future is going to the hands of&nbsp; fashion's Sunderland-born designer Gareth Pugh.&nbsp; <br/>It seems that the head of PPR&nbsp; Francois-Henri Pinault want to see other British man as successor of British "Bad Boy".<br/><br/>The sameness of McQueen and Gareth Pugh is their theatricality. Style.com describes Pugh as the "latest addition to a long tradition of fashion-as-performance-art that stretches back through Alexander McQueen, John Galliano, and Vivienne Westwood to the eighties club culture of Leigh Bowery." Probably the boosters of Pugh such as&nbsp; Kylie Minogue, Lady Gaga and American Vogue editor Anna Wintour will ardently lobby for Pugh's new chair.&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; ]]></description>

					  <title><![CDATA[Aquascutum Designer&#039;s Shift after London Fashion Week]]></title>
					  <link>http://www.fashionnewspaper.com/articles/3906/1/Aquascutum-Designer039s-Shift-after-London-Fashion-Week/Page1.html</link>
					  <description><![CDATA[
<p>Aquascutum's long-time designers Michael Herz and Graeme Fidler are leaving the brand. Up to now they acted as chief designers of women's and men's wear collections of the Aquascutum. </p>
<p>Their cooperative work at Aquascutum began in 2000 and 2002, respectively. During the LFW 2010-11 Michael Herz label's women's wear designer showed her last collection under Aquascutum.</p>
<p>"They've had a great time at the brand, but they want to move on, and we fully understand that," said Earl, Aquascutum's chief executive. "We wish them well, and the situation is amicable," she told WWD.</p>]]></description>

					  <title><![CDATA[Greta Garbo Exhibition by Salvatore Ferragamo]]></title>
					  <link>http://www.fashionnewspaper.com/articles/3739/1/Greta-Garbo-Exhibition-by-Salvatore-Ferragamo/Page1.html</link>
					  <description><![CDATA[
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t; TEXT-ALIGN: justify"><span lang="EN-US" style="mso-ansi-language: EN-US">The day before the <?xml:namespace prefix = st1 ns = "urn:schemas-microsoft-com:office:smarttags" /><st1:City w:st="on">Milan</st1:City>'s Triennale began to exhibit style secrets of <st1:place w:st="on">Hollywood</st1:place> star Swedish-born actress Greta Garbo. </span><span lang="EN-US" style="mso-ansi-language: EN-US">The organizers of exhibition are Salvatore Ferragamo Italia S.p.A. and Garbo's great-nephew, Craig Reisfeld.<span style="mso-spacerun: yes">&nbsp; <br/></span><?xml:namespace prefix = o ns = "urn:schemas-microsoft-com:office:office" /><o:p></o:p></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t; TEXT-ALIGN: justify"><span lang="EN-US" style="mso-ansi-language: EN-US"><br/>For the public display the organizers are offering actress' film clips, photos, screen costumes from the movies such as "Inspiration" and "Queen Christina." The other part of display named "Everyday Elegance" includes Garbo's collection of dresses, camel coats, hats, gloves, raincoats and scarves. Also there are actress' inexpensive shirts and trousers sewn in <st1:City w:st="on"><st1:place w:st="on">Hollywood</st1:place></st1:City> by Watson. Among these items were her Louis Vuitton suitcases, design pieces by Givenchy, Pucci and <st1:State w:st="on"><st1:place w:st="on">New York</st1:place></st1:State> couturier Valentina. These carefully preserved items by the Reisfeld family never been displayed before. <br/><o:p></o:p></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t; TEXT-ALIGN: justify"><span lang="EN-US" style="mso-ansi-language: EN-US"><br/>Italian shoemaker Ferragoma crafted his first shoes for Garbo in <st1:City w:st="on"><st1:place w:st="on">Hollywood</st1:place></st1:City> in <st1:metricconverter w:st="on" ProductID="1927. In">1927. In</st1:metricconverter> the bio of Ferragamo he reconts Garo when she told him, &#8216;I don&#8217;t have any shoes. And I want to walk.&#8217; &#8220;In five sessions I created for her a series of low-heeled, closed-toe styles,&#8221; he recalled. &#8220; &#8230; as she paced the floor of the salon in the first pair she smiled at me as she smiled in &#8220;Ninotchka&#8221; &#8230; altogether she ordered seventy pairs.&#8221;<span style="mso-spacerun: yes">&nbsp;&nbsp; <br/></span><o:p></o:p></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t; TEXT-ALIGN: justify"><span lang="EN-US" style="mso-ansi-language: EN-US"><br/>The duration of expo at Triennale will last untill May. Further the exhibition venue will move to the <st1:PlaceName w:st="on">Ferragamo</st1:PlaceName> <st1:PlaceType w:st="on">Museum</st1:PlaceType>, Palazzo Spini Feroni, in <st1:City w:st="on"><st1:place w:st="on">Florence</st1:place></st1:City>.<span style="mso-spacerun: yes">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; </span><o:p></o:p></span></p>]]></description>
